A photo of a Japanese girl who lost her sight as a result of witnessing the atomic bomb attack on Hiroshima on August 6, 1945.
The bomb killed over 65,000 people. Though the atomic bombs forced Japan to surrender, the US are still heavily criticized over the gross damage and devastation it caused. Furthermore, majority of casualties were innocent civilians. It was a major stance against the communist aggression by the USSR in Manchuria.
Bombs in war are still the most highly debated topic surrounding warfare, and till this day, this was 1 out of the 2 nuclear attacks in history.
